Rumah  >  Artikel  >  rangka kerja php  >  Bagaimana untuk memuatkan kaedah luaran dalam thinkphp

Bagaimana untuk memuatkan kaedah luaran dalam thinkphp

藏色散人
藏色散人asal
2022-12-07 09:11:591283semak imbas

thinkphp memuatkan kaedah luaran: 1. Import pustaka kelas melalui kaedah import, dan sintaks importnya adalah seperti "import("Org.Util.Date");" 2. Gunakan vendor untuk mengimport luaran kelas, dan sintaks importnya adalah seperti berikut "Vendor('Zend.Filter.Dir');".

Bagaimana untuk memuatkan kaedah luaran dalam thinkphp

Persekitaran pengendalian tutorial ini: sistem Windows 7, thinkphp versi 3.2, komputer Dell G3.

Bagaimana untuk memuatkan kaedah luaran dalam thinkphp?

Cara Thinkphp mengimport kelas luar

Saya percaya ramai orang bermasalah dengan pelbagai percubaan yang tidak berjaya untuk menggunakan kelas luaran apabila menggunakan TP

Di bawah Biar saya memperkenalkan kaedah rujukan dan memberi perhatian kepada butiran secara terperinci

Muatkan perpustakaan kelas pihak ketiga secara manual

Memandangkan perpustakaan kelas pihak ketiga tidak mempunyai ruang nama tertentu, anda perlu untuk menggunakan kaedah berikut untuk mengimportnya secara manual

1 Kaedah import boleh mengimport mana-mana perpustakaan kelas

① Import pakej perpustakaan kelas org

import("Org.Util.Date");

②Import kelas di bawah modul Laman Utama

import("Home.Util.UserUtil");

③Import kelas di bawah modul semasa

import("@.Util.Array");

④Import pakej perpustakaan kelas vendor

import('Vendor.Zend.Server');

Beri perhatian kepada ketepatan laluan itu. Selepas berjaya memperkenalkan kelas ini, pastikan anda membuat contoh kelas ini sebelum memanggilnya.

2. Gunakan vendor untuk mengimport kelas luaran

Nota: Terdapat perbezaan kes di bawah hos Unix atau Linux, jadi apabila menggunakan kaedah import, perhatikan kes nama direktori dan nama perpustakaan kelas , jika tidak import akan gagal.

Vendor('Zend.Filter.Dir');

Sila rujuk manual rasmi untuk butiran: http://document.thinkphp.cn/manual_3_2.html#autoload;

Pembelajaran yang disyorkan: "Tutorial Video thinkPHP "

Atas ialah kandungan terperinci Bagaimana untuk memuatkan kaedah luaran dalam thinkphp.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n